Islamabad Islamabad Compucraze Internet Services ( Address : H.No.374,St.#13,F-10/2 Islamabad City : Islamabad Phone Number/s : Website : http://www.compucraze.com [ Click to open in a new tab ] Related Listings from Islamabad area Cybervision International View Details Zatsol View Details Gillani Software (smc-pvt) Ltd View Details Dimension Technologies View Details